My name is Bryan and I’m new to the forum. I’ve been using Lenovo ThinkPads (models with i5 and i7 processors) for about a year and overall I really like them. However, I’ve recently run into a strange issue and was hoping to get some advice.
Every now and then, when I wake the laptop from sleep, the screen stays completely black even though the keyboard backlight and power LED come on. The only way I can get the display working again is by forcing a hard reboot. It doesn’t happen every time, but often enough to be frustrating.
I’ve already tried updating BIOS, reinstalling graphics drivers, and tweaking sleep settings, but the problem still shows up.
Has anyone else run into this kind of issue? Any suggestions on what else I could check?
